On 26.11.2013 08:22, Beeblebrox wrote:
>>> Found the problem. Either use -d or upgrade.
> The -d flag did not work (gave error), so I I upgraded. Works now!
>
-d requires an argument (consult --help)
> # grub-mknetdir --net-directory=/data/tftp --subdir=boot
> Netboot directory for i386-pc created. Configure your DHCP server to
> point to /data/tftp/boot/i386-pc/core.0
>
> The DHCP message (where to point) is also very helpful and important.
